Cy Slapnicka

Cyril Charles Slapnicka

Position: Pitcher
Bats: Both, Throws: Right
Height: 5' 10", Weight: 165 lb.

Born: March 23, 1886 in Cedar Rapids, IA (All Transactions)
Debut: September 26, 1911
Teams (by GP): Pirates/Cubs 1911-1918

Final Game: August 8, 1918
Died: October 20, 1979 in Cedar Rapids, IA
Buried: Cedar Memorial Park, Cedar Rapids, IA
